Electric motors are responsible for a substantial portion of energy consumption in manufacturing facilities. By optimizing the performance of these motors, manufacturers can achieve significant energy savings. One effective way to enhance motor efficiency is through the implementation of Variable Frequency Drives (VFDs).

Variable Frequency Drives (VFDs) offer several advantages:

  • Energy Efficiency: VFDs adjust the motor speed to match the load requirements, reducing energy consumption significantly.
  • Improved Process Control: They provide precise control over motor speed and torque, enhancing product quality and process efficiency.
  • Extended Equipment Life: By minimizing mechanical stress, VFDs can prolong the lifespan of equipment and reduce maintenance costs.
